Adjective [Ancient Greek]

IPA: /ai̯.nós/, /ɛˈnos/, /eˈnos/, /ai̯.nós/ (note: 5ᵗʰ BCE Attic), /ɛˈnos/ (note: 1ˢᵗ CE Egyptian), /ɛˈnos/ (note: 4ᵗʰ CE Koine), /eˈnos/ (note: 10ᵗʰ CE Byzantine), /eˈnos/ (note: 15ᵗʰ CE Constantinopolitan)
Etymology: Connected with Sanskrit एनस् (énas, “evil, calamity, atrocity”) by Pokorny.   1. horrible, dread, dreadful
